Which PMHNP is it?

  • A psychiatric mental health nurse practitioner (PMHNP) is an advanced practice registered nurse (APRN) who is trained to assist individuals, families, groups, or communities with their mental health needs.

What is a mental and psychiatric nurse practitioner?

  • Individuals, families, groups, and communities are all served by a PMHNP. For each client, PMHNPs follow a multi-stage procedure: determining the requirements for mental health care, coming up with a nursing diagnosis and a plan of care, carrying out the nursing procedure, and assessing how well it works

What does a mental and psychiatric nurse practitioner do?

  • To diagnose, treat, and improve the outcomes of patients facing psychiatric or mental health challenges, PMHNPs combine a variety of nursing, psychosocial, and neurobiological expertise and methods.
  • PMHNPs carry out a wide range of duties on a daily basis that contribute to the development of therapeutic relationships with their patients. A PMHNP’s day-to-day strategies and methods may vary based on their area of expertise and clientele. However, the assessment, diagnosis, planning, treatment, and evaluation of patients are typically included in a PMHNP’s scope of practice, which may last for months or even years for each individual patient.
  • In addition to providing individualized care, PMHNPs collaborate with patients’ families, engage their colleagues in the health care industry in dialogue and research, and actively educate communities to reduce mental health stigma and the demand for mental health services.

Where does a mental and psychiatric nurse practitioner work?

  • PMHNPs are able to work in a variety of settings. Hospitals, primary care settings, clinics, schools, telemedicine settings, public health facilities, and private practices are all common workplaces.
  • PMHNPs can work with a variety of patient profiles, depending on the setting. Adolescents and adults who are dealing with anxiety or depression, people who are contemplating suicide, children who have been exposed to adverse or traumatic events, soldiers or other members of the armed forces, and people with opioid, alcohol, or other substance use disorders are all examples of these.

How long does it take to become a nurse practitioner in mental health and psychiatry?

  • Your prior education may affect how long it takes to become a PMHNP. MSN PMHNP programs are open to applicants with a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N) degree. However, obtaining a PMHNP may take longer if you are changing careers or a registered nurse without a BSN. It is essential to take into account the amount of time required to complete the national certification and state licensure requirements.
